Description
Anti-Human TSHR Antibody (SAA0401) [SAA0401] (HB852013) is a mouse monoclonal antibody detecting TSHR in ELISA, FCM, IHC, WB. Suitable for Human.

Background

Thyrotropin receptor (TSHR/LGR3) is a ~86 kDa protein. Receptor for the thyroid-stimulating hormone (TSH) or thyrotropin. Also acts as a receptor for the heterodimeric glycoprotein hormone (GPHA2:GPHB5) or thyrostimulin. TSHR is coupled to G(s) proteins and mediates the activation of adenylate cyclase. This leads to the generation of cyclic adenosine monophosphate (cAMP), which in turn activates protein kinase A (PKA). PKA subsequently phosphorylates downstream targets involved in thyroid hormone biosynthesis and secretion, including thyroid peroxidase (TPO) and the sodium/iodide symporter (NIS).
